Northcentral Technical College sits in Wausau, WI.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 23 general computer programming degrees were awarded at Northcentral Technical College.

Studying Online at Northcentral Technical College

Many students take online classes at Northcentral Technical College. Among 6,746 students, 1,642 (24%) studied exclusively online and 896 (13%) took at least some classes online.

Program-wide, General Computer Programming graduates at Northcentral Technical College are 17% women (4) and 83% men (19).

General Computer Programming Associate’s Program at Northcentral Technical College

Of the 5 associate’s general computer programming degrees awarded at Northcentral Technical College, 40% were women (2) and 60% were men (3).
